La Mesa Motel
About this property
The La Mesa Motel was a historic motel on Central Avenue (former U.S. Route 66) in Albuquerque, New Mexico, which was notable as one of the best-preserved prewar Route 66 motels remaining in the city. It was built in 1938 and was added to the New Mexico State Register of Cultural Properties and the National Register of Historic Places in 1993. The building was demolished in March, 2003, and replaced with a larger two-story motel. The motel was a linear, one-story building with 14 rooms. All of the rooms except the northernmost unit faced east toward the parking lot, while the final unit extended east from the main block and faced south. The design featured modest Pueblo Revival elements, including vigas, slightly curved parapets, small porches supported by corbeled wooden posts, and a battered chimney. The office and manager's residence were at the front of the building; the office was probably a later addition.

When was La Mesa Motel listed on the National Register?
La Mesa Motel was listed on the National Register of Historic Places on November 22, 1993.
What type of historic resource is La Mesa Motel?
La Mesa Motel is classified as a building in the National Register of Historic Places.
What is the period of significance for La Mesa Motel?
The period of significance for La Mesa Motel is recorded as the industrial era, specifically around 1938.
